Saint George´s CollegeEnglish II Unit

OBJECTIVES

1. To read and comprehend a variety of authentic and adapted texts.

2. To write guided texts that express ideas clearly, in an organized manner, with good word choice, and appropriate conventions.

3. To listen and comprehend the meaning of adapted and authentic oral texts.

5. To express ourselves orally conveying meaning in conversations and oral reports.

6. To explore connections between content material and our Catholic identity.

7. To foster interest and engagement with the English language through technology, using different TICs responsibly and effectively to obtain information and to create texts, citing other’s work and respecting intellectual property.

8. To reinforce listening skills taken from KET test based exercises.
